Today, I hit a new personal record for overclocking. I am into 2nd hr of Prime95 at 3852 MHz (428 MHz x 9 multi) using 1.375 v in BIOS (1.376 showing in CPU-z).
My temperatures are 68, 65, 65, 68 C, and if this proves Prime 95 stable for 8 hours I will be VERY happy. If I knew there were such good chips out there, I would have gotten rid of my Q6600 B3 a long time ago.
Note that my current performance is with an unlapped CPU and a lapped Thermalright 120 Extreme heat sink with one Scythe SFF-21F fan.
Given this chips current performance, it seems likely that I will be able to break the 4000 MHz mmark once I water cool it.
